The ingredients needed to make Braised Pork and Potatoes:
  1. Make ready 3 potatoes (200~250g )(peel and cut into bite sizes)
  2. Prepare 1/3 carrot (peel and chop into chunks)
  3. Get 1 onion (peel and slice thinly)
  4. Make ready 100 g pork (rub 1 Tbsp sake in it and leave for 15 mins)
  5. Prepare 1 Tbsp sake (not including sake used for the pork)
  6. Take 2 Tbsp mirin
  7. Take 2 tsp sugar
  8. Prepare 2 Tbsp soy sauce
  9. Get 300 ml water
  10. Make ready 4 g bonito flakes (wrap up in a kitchen paper or put in a tea bag)
Instructions to make Braised Pork and Potatoes:
  1. Put all ingredients in a pot, put a small drop lid directly on the food (you can substitute with aluminum foil or kitchen paper, cut into the size of inner pot)
  2. Put on a pot's lid and turn on the medium heat. Once it begins to a simmer, skim off the foam if it rises on the surface, take off the pan's lid, lower the heat (low), and keep simmering for 15 mins.
  3. Let it cool to let the taste soak into the vegetables. Just before eating, heat again and cook until the liquid is almost gone.
